What is Fundamental Analysis?

Fundamental analysis is the method of assessing an asset’s value by examining its intrinsic factors. Factors like

  • Scrutinizing financial statements
  • Studying market trends
  • Considering macroeconomic indicators

Cryptocurrency vs Stock

Conducting fundamental analysis for cryptocurrencies and stocks has its differences. 

  1. Cryptocurrencies face greater volatility due to their nascent market, while stocks have a longer track record.
  2. Cryptocurrencies also rely heavily on technology and adoption, whereas stocks are influenced by broader economic factors.

Fundamental Analysis

This section talks about factors with which fundamental analysis of cryptocurrencies as well as stocks can be assessed. 

  • Cryptocurrency Valuation

Fundamental analysis in cryptocurrencies can be assessed by considering factors such as:

  1. Blockchain Technology
    1. The technology behind the cryptocurrency, its security, scalability, and features
  2. Use Cases
    1. The practical applications and real-world uses of the cryptocurrency
  3. Adoption and Popularity
    1. The level of public interest, trust, and usage of the cryptocurrency
  4. Network Activity
    1. The number of transactions, active addresses, and overall activity on the blockchain
  • Stock Analysis

Fundamental analysis of stocks can be assessed by considering factors such as:

  1. Financial Statements
    1. For company’s financial health, cash flow statements are crucial, which include:
      1. reviewing balance sheets
      2. income statements
  2. ‘Earnings Per Share (EPS)’
    1. Shows how much money the company made for each share of stock.
  3. ‘Price-to-Earnings (P/E) Ratio’
    1. Checks the stock to see if it’s overvalued or undervalued.
  4. Dividend Yield
    1. Means how much real-time money might get back from owning a certain stock.

Metric System

In both cryptocurrencies and stocks, fundamental analysis relies on various important metrics for valuation.

  • For stocks, metrics such as earnings and revenue reveal a company’s profitability. Market capitalization reflects a company’s total value.
  • In cryptocurrencies, supply metrics like circulating and total supply are crucial, along with network activity which indicates how actively a cryptocurrency is being used.

Risks And Challenges

The Fundamental analysis comes with inherent risks such as 

  • Misinformation
  • Inaccurate data
  • Biased analysis
  • Economic downturns
  • Sudden technological change

These can lead to poor investment decisions and could disrupt predicted outcomes. Moreover, 

  • market irrationality
  • driven by emotions rather than logic

These can create price fluctuations that defy fundamental analysis predictions. 

Recognizing these risks and continuously updating analysis is essential for navigating the uncertainties of the financial markets effectively.
